  1. viper 5902...is the best. had mine put in my 08 tahoe for about 6 months already, the range is super nice, you dont have to worry about buying new batteries for the remote just plug it in the wall for 30 minutes once every 2 to 3 weeks. its a color lcd screen, it tells you the inside temperature at request, u can lock the remote so you dont push buttons on accident, u can adjust the shock sensor from the remote, wiring is super simple if you have a newer car. Has a ton of options you can pretty much do anything you want with this.

    only cons are it comes with a built in shock sensor in the module, and your not suppose to mount the module on metal so the shock sensor is not that sensitive even at its highest level. simple fix - just have them add a shock sensor and mount it somewhere that benenits the shock sensor not the module.

    the color LCD kills it, its the best.

    I would suggest this alarm to everyone..only thing you better be prepare for the price tag more if you have a newer style car. i paid $650.00 installed including alarm, modules and warranty.

  2. 4 12s = 452.16in^2

    2 15s = 353.25in^2

    So like Kranny said, theoretically the 4 12s will be louder.

    Remember though, that the BTLs are rated for 2,000 RMS (Yes I know people put more on them), but let's say you put a good clean 2,000 RMS on both, that equals out to be 4,000 RMS.

    The L7s are only rated 750 (I've never personally seen them pushed over 750 rms) so let's say you send them a good clean 750 RMS each, you end up with 3,000 RMS.

    Just something to remember when you are planning on powering whatever setup you go with.

    my 4 12s are kicker L7's and are square so the actual surface area for those are different then the way you do round subs.

    4 12s = 576.0in^2 not 452.16
